Yoga therapy is an evidence-informed approach to supporting physical and emotional well-being through customized movement, breathwork, and mind–body practices.
Unlike group yoga or fitness-based classes, yoga therapy is:
Individualized
Assessment-based
Goal-oriented
Designed to complement medical treatment
Sessions integrate functional movement, breath science, and nervous system regulation to support the body’s natural healing processes.

Yoga therapy is not currently billable through insurance.
Clients pay privately for sessions and can also use their HSA/FSA funds.
Yoga therapy can support clinical outcomes by:
Improving mobility and functional strength
Reducing musculoskeletal pain
Enhancing balance and proprioception
Regulating the autonomic nervous system
Supporting adherence to rehabilitation and wellness plans
Reducing anxiety and stress-related symptoms
Complementing cardiac, PT, or mental health treatment
It is particularly beneficial for patients who:
Need a gentle, personalized approach
Struggle with traditional exercise models
Benefit from mind-body integration
Require nervous system stabilization alongside physical care
Have complex or comorbid conditions
